What Recruitment VAs Handle in 2026

The scope of work managed by recruitment virtual assistants has expanded significantly beyond basic data entry and scheduling. Modern recruitment VAs operate across the full hiring lifecycle:

Candidate Sourcing and Screening

  • Boolean search execution across LinkedIn, job boards, and talent databases
  • Initial resume screening against position requirements
  • Candidate outreach via email, phone, and social platforms
  • Preliminary phone screening and qualification interviews

Interview Coordination

  • Calendar management across multiple recruiters and hiring managers
  • Scheduling complex multi-round interview sequences
  • Sending confirmation and preparation materials to candidates
  • Managing interview feedback collection from panel members

Onboarding Support

  • Paperwork delivery and completion tracking
  • Background check coordination
  • New hire documentation processing
  • First-week orientation scheduling and logistics

Database and CRM Management

  • Applicant tracking system (ATS) data entry and maintenance
  • Candidate pipeline reporting and analytics
  • Client relationship documentation
  • Placement tracking and follow-up scheduling

The Shift to Direct-Hire Models

One of the most notable trends in 2026 is the move toward direct-hire staffing models for virtual assistants. Industry analysis shows that more companies are opting for arrangements where they own the working relationship from day one.

Direct-hire advantages include:

  • Full Performance Oversight - agencies manage their VA directly, setting expectations and measuring output without intermediary reporting layers
  • No Recurring Markups - eliminating the 30-50% margins that VA staffing agencies typically charge
  • Direct Compensation Control - paying the VA directly with full transparency into compensation structures
  • Stronger Working Relationships - building loyalty and institutional knowledge over time

This model requires more upfront effort in recruitment and onboarding but delivers better long-term value for agencies that plan to scale their VA support.

Technology Integration

Modern recruitment VAs are expected to be proficient with the technology stack that powers staffing operations:

  • ATS Platforms - Bullhorn, JobAdder, Greenhouse, Lever
  • Communication Tools - Zoom, Slack, Microsoft Teams
  • Sourcing Platforms - LinkedIn Recruiter, Indeed, ZipRecruiter
  • Automation Tools - Zapier, Make (formerly Integromat)
  • CRM Systems - Salesforce, HubSpot, custom recruitment CRMs

The combination of VA expertise and these platforms creates a force-multiplied operation where each recruiter can handle significantly more open positions without sacrificing candidate experience.

Scaling Strategies for Agencies

Staffing agencies looking to integrate VAs effectively should consider a phased approach:

Phase 1 - Administrative Offload (Month 1-2): Start with calendar management, data entry, and basic candidate communication to free up recruiter time immediately.

Phase 2 - Sourcing Support (Month 3-4): Expand to candidate sourcing, initial screening, and pipeline management as the VA learns the agency's standards and processes.

Phase 3 - Full Operational Integration (Month 5+): Move into client-facing coordination, onboarding management, and analytics reporting with the VA functioning as a core team member.
